DIAGNOSTIC TROUBLE CODE CHART
CAN Communication System
DTC No. | Detection Item | DTC Output from | Link |
B1003 | ECU Malfunction | Central gateway ECU (network gateway ECU) | |
U0199 | Lost Communication with "Door Control Module A" | Main Body | |
U0200 | Lost Communication with "Door Control Module B" | Main Body | |
U0208 | Lost Communication with "Seat Control Module A" | Main Body | |
U0230 | Lost Communication with Rear Gate Module | Main Body | |
U1002 | Lost Communication with Gateway Module (Main Body ECU) | Main Body | |
U1115 | Lost Communication with Tilt & Telescopic Module | Main Body | |
